What is PPPoker

To jump right into the realm of “pppoker cheat” talk, let’s first learn what PPPoker is.

PPPoker is a cell phone application with which players can establish private poker clubs, plan games, and host tournaments. It’s unusual in that:

  • It’s an intermediary platform, not an actual real-money poker site.
  • Real-money transactions are handled by the clubs outside the app.
  • Multiple poker variants are supported such as Texas Hold’em, Omaha, and Open-Face Chinese.

With its decentralized structure, with private clubs looking after their own money, the issues of security, fairness, and cheating will be a given.

Is PPPoker Safe

By its design, PPPoker places game integrity first. The site employs multiple security measures:

  • Gaming Laboratories International (GLI) RNG certification
  • Robust encryption standards
  • Regular software updates

PPPoker’s security, however, mostly relies on the person operating the club. Private clubs handle membership and finances, so an ill-intentioned operator of a club could provide opportunities for a pppoker cheat or some other form of cheating.

Common Forms of PPPoker Cheat Activity

While PPPoker aims to be fair, where there is competition, some players seek shortcuts. These are the most debated and dreaded forms of pppoker cheat activity:

Collusion

Collusion refers to two or more players exchanging information regarding their hands to obtain an unfair advantage.  In PPPoker may be done through:

Real-time communication (calls, messaging apps)

  • Chip dumping
  • Pre-planned betting tactics
  • Indications of collusion:
  • Regular soft-playing among some players
  • Unusual folding habits when a player bets
  • Inexplicable chip activity during tournaments

Ghosting

Ghosting occurs when an experienced player tips off another player in the middle of a hand or plays for them. It is particularly risky in environments such as PPPoker, where identification is limited.

Indications of ghosting:

  • Improvement in play style without warning
  • Inordinate time before followed by immaculate decision
  • Inconsistencies in player behavior over sessions

Multi-Accounting

Multi-accounting is where a single user has several accounts playing at the same table, which amounts to stacking the deck against the rest.

Indications of multi-accounting:

  • Unconventional betting coordination among unknown accounts
  • Consistent suspicious account behavior across tables

Software Aids (Real-Time Assistance Tools) Usage

While PPPoker prohibits third-party software integration, some players try to utilize unauthorized real-time solvers, odds calculators, or HUDs (Heads-Up Displays).

Indications of software assistance:

  • Perfect play in difficult situations
  • Quick, statistically perfect decision-making

Superuser Exploits (Very Uncommon)

A superuser exploit would enable a player to view other players’ hole cards. There is no public record of superusers in PPPoker, but past poker scandals (such as Ultimate Bet) keep players on their toes.

How Real is the PPPoker Cheat Threat

Let’s be clear: most PPPoker games are on the level. The vast majority of players and clubs play fairly.

But since PPPoker is a club system where admins control access, chips, and in some cases even the game setup, the threat lies if you play in unverified or untrusted clubs.

  • Therefore, “pppoker cheat” problems happen:
  • Loosely governed private clubs
  • Among the club admin friends
  • High-stakes games with bad actors

How to Protect Yourself from PPPoker Cheat Scenarios

Taking care of yourself is essential if you’re grinding low-stakes or playing high-stakes tourneys. Here’s how to protect yourself:

Join Reputable Clubs

  • Join clubs only that have been suggested by trusted sources or poker forums.
  • Investigate club histories and admin reputations.
  • Join clubs that are affiliated with big, reputable unions.

Observe Player Behavior

Pay attention to unusual betting patterns, suspicious folds, or consistent river bluffs.

Trust your instincts if play feels “off.”

Use Hand Tracking

  • Maintain session and hand records.
  • Examine suspicious hands for odd patterns.

Report Suspicious Activity

  • PPPoker provides the ability to report suspicious activity.
  • Take screenshots or hand histories when you can.

Avoid High-Risk Games

  • Avoid super high-stakes games if you don’t know everyone at the table.
  • Scams and collusion thrive where large amounts of money are exchanged.

What PPPoker Is Doing to Prevent Cheating

PPPoker considers cheating serious and takes the following actions:

  • Random Number Generation (RNG) Certification: Provides fair dealing.
  • Account Verification: Particularly for club owners.
  • Club Moderation Tools: Administrators can monitor player activity and ban troublemakers.
  • Anti-Collusion Algorithms: Identify strange betting and folding patterns.

Still, PPPoker cannot regulate club integrity, hence players need to do their homework.
